How Submersible Pump Water Extraction Works

When water damage strikes, every minute counts. That’s why our team springs into action, using specialized equ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age. We’ll deploy a submersible pump to remove standing water, and then use a combination of air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your space. Industrial-Grade Drying Technology
Standard fans aren't enough for deep-seated moisture. We deploy commercial LGR dehumidifiers and high-velocity air movers to extract water from hidden cavities, preventing long-term structural rot and hazardous mold growth.

Free, Comprehensive Thermal Imaging Inspections
Moisture can hide behind drywall and under flooring where you can't see it. We use advanced infrared cameras to pinpoint the exact boundaries of the damage, so you only pay for necessary repairs.
